WHO IS MY GARBAGE HAULER?
Ebensburg Borough contracts out garbage pick-up in the borough to one hauler. Pro Disposal is the collection agency. Residents living south of High Street will have garbage collected on Thursdays. Residents living north of High Street will have garbage collected on Fridays (Starting 1/1/18). Residents are permitted four 30-gallon bags per pick-up. Extra bag stickers may be purchased at the Borough office for $2 per sticker. Garbage is billed bi-monthly with your water and sewer bill. View current rates here.

ARE THERE RECYCLING FACILITIES AVAILABLE?
Curbside recycling will be picked up weekly with trash.
Materials included in Ebensburg’s residential recycling program:
Glass Containers
Aluminum Cans
Steel & Bi-metallic Cans
Plastics (#1 through #7)
Cardboard (cereal and food boxes, gift boxes, etc.)
Corrugated Boxes (moving boxes, packing boxes, etc.)
Newspaper – stack and tie with string or place in a paper bag or a container of its own. DO NOT put in plastic bags or mix loose newspaper with other recyclables.
ALL items must be placed in blue recycling containers for pick-up; DO NOT put recyclables in PLASTIC BAGS
Ebensburg Borough is not large enough to be required to have a recycling program, but instead does so voluntarily. Free recycling containers are available at the borough office for those wishing to participate.
The closest drop-off site is located on Manor Drive, next to Lions ballpark and near Lake Rowena. For other recycling options, please contact the Cambria County recycling office at (814) 472-2109 or visit www.cambriarecycles.org

WHEN CAN I BURN IN THE BOROUGH?
Open burning is permitted in Ebensburg within the borough on Tuesdays between 8 AM and 5 PM, and on Saturday morning between 8 AM and 12 noon. All fires must be contained in a receptacle designed for burning.

WHERE CAN I RECYCLE EXPIRED/UNUSED MEDICATION?
If you have prescription or over-the-counter and other unused medicines, drop boxes are a safe, effective and environmentally-friendly way to dispose of them. There are several drop boxes conveniently located in Ebensburg at the following locations:
Cambria County Courthouse, 200 S. Center Street, Ebensburg
Pennsylvania State Police, 100 Casale Court, Ebensburg
Cambria Township Municipal Building, 184 Municipal Road, Ebensburg

WHY SHOULD I RECYCLE?
Benefits of Recycling
- Reduces the amount of waste sent to landfills and incinerators
- Conserves natural resources such as timber, water and minerals
- Increases economic security by tapping a domestic source of materials
- Prevents pollution by reducing the need to collect new raw materials
- Saves energy
- Supports American manufacturing and conserves valuable resources
- Helps create jobs in the recycling and manufacturing industries in the United StatesFor more information, visit: https://www.epa.gov/recycle/recycling-basics.
